Before HARTZ, KELLY, and BACHARACH, Circuit Judges.
KELLY, Circuit Judge.
In these consolidated appeals, Plaintiffs-Appellants1 challenge the district court's denial of a preliminary injunction seeking to enjoin the New Mexico Department of Health's ("NM DOH") Second Amended Public Health Order ("PHO") which restricts firearm carry in public parks and playgrounds in the...
